Innovation at Dartmouth Carnival

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The first intercollegiate ski and snow shoe meet ever held in the United States will be the feature of this year's Carnival of the Dartmouth Outing Club on February 11, 12 and 13. Entries have already been received from Williams, McGill, New Hampshire State and Dartmouth. The intercollegiate competition will consist of the following events: Two and one-half mile ski cross-country run; three mile snow-shoe run; dashes of one hundred and two hundred and twenty yards for skis and snow-shoes; and ski jumping contest.

The events are open to any undergraduate or graduate student in an American or Canadian college or university. Members of visiting teams will be guests at the various dramatic and other performances during the Carnival and will live in the college dormitories.
